IT Managed Services

It is difficult to deny the value of working with an outside IT service provider. The majority of companies using managed services describe their partnership with their provider as a collaborative arrangement with their internal IT department, leading one to believe that certain aspects of IT management fall within the scope of the MSP, while others are preferably handled in-house. The driving force behind these business owners is to improve and enhance the capabilities of the in-house IT team, not to replace them entirely.

More Efficient and Reliable IT Operations

Outsourcing IT not only ensures that an extra team of IT experts can help resolve any issues or concerns, but also that they can benefit from having access to the latest and most advanced technology and innovative business-grade solutions that will help maximize uptime and profitability. Such technologies shall include such things as:

  • Remote Monitoring and Management (RMM)
  • Backup and Disaster Recovery (BDR)
  • Cloud Computing

By investing in these tools, the entire IT infrastructure will become more reliable and reliable, labor constraints will be overcome and internal IT departments will be able to remain in control of the situation.

A Proactive Approach to Maintenance

Security solutions and services such as RMM are always working to detect potential threats, vulnerabilities, or disturbances. When we provide fully managed IT support, bugs and issues can most often be troubleshot and remediated before they are ever a concern to the business owner.

Cloud data management is expected to provide support from managed service providers, and when businesses work with the right MSP, they can take advantage of proactive business continuity solutions, such as BDR, by combining RMM intelligence with regular and encrypted backups, cloud computing, and virtualization.
